Lucid, a high-end electric vehicle manufacturer with its headquarters in California, declared in March 2022 that the Lucid Air uses its SiCMOSFET. A bidirectional on-board charger (OBC) and a DC-DC converter are integrated into the vehicle's main on-board charging unit, called the Wunderbox. Thanks to the better performance of the SiC MOSFET, the enhanced power factor correction circuit in this OBC can operate at high switching frequencies. The SCT3040K and SCT3080K SiC MOSFETs from ROHM offer increased performance at high frequency and high temperature, which has allowed Lucid to reduce the size of the design while simultaneously lowering power losses, resulting in excellent charging efficiency.
Also, The development of a new generation of low-voltage (LV) MOSFETs with lower Rss(on) for battery protection circuit modules (PCMs) in smartphones was announced by Magnachip Semiconductor Corporation in January 2022. Extended battery life and improved battery safety features are vital as the market for premium 5G and long term evolution (LTE) handsets grows. The processing of a huge volume of data for quick download and upload requires long-lasting batteries with high endurance, which are especially necessary for 5G phones. The latest generation of LV MOSFETs, according to the manufacturer, include enhanced overvoltage and overcurrent protection features that help prolong battery life and lessen overheating problems.

April 2022, In terms of the future, researchers at the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) are implementing cutting-edge power electronics technologies to transform clean energy mobility, which goes beyond light-duty electric vehicles (EVs). It can regulate the flow of electricity to power powerful and sophisticated electric equipment. The devices are utilised in heavy-duty vehicles, railroads, and aircraft. NREL is concentrating on new research initiatives in grid storage, sustainable aviation, and energy-efficient computing with the help of the Advanced Research Projects Agency-Energy (ARPA-E) programmes of the U.S. Department of Energy.
